Freegle Grow Your Own Event Report - 17th April 2013

Last Sunday, nearly 60 people came to Bolton Memorial Hall, near Appleby for Penrith & Eden Freegle’s Grow Your Own Give & Take event. Visitors were encouraged to bring gardening items that they had spare or no longer needed, such …

OUR SustainEden BID WAS SUCCESSFUL!! - 3rd September 2012

Our bid to secure almost £1million of funding for Eden from the Big Lottery Communities Living Sustainably Fund was successful. We are pleased to annouce that CAfS, in conjunction with its partners, will be delivering the 3 year SustainEden project …
